For the second straight game, the Chicago Blackhawks lost a key member of their defence because of a vicious check against the boards behind the net.
To add insult to injury, Anaheim's Saku Koivu scored the go-ahead goal late in the third period - just seconds after a blind-side cross-check by Corey Perry against defenceman Brent Sopel that easily could have been called interference. As a result, the Ducks won 3-2 Wednesday night and handed the Blackhawks their third straight loss - preventing them from tying idle San Jose for the Western Conference lead.
